whoever

Pronunciation: [huˈɛvər]

Word

Context: “identification”

(pronoun) this word refers to any person or people, no matter who they are. It's used when you're talking about someone and you don't know or don't care who that person is.

Example

Whoever finishes the homework first will get a treat.

Example

Whoever didn't help out is not going to get any thanks.

Context: “permission”

(pronoun) this word can also mean that any person can do something. It's used when you want to say that anyone is allowed to take action.

Example

You can invite whoever you want to the party.

Example

She won't allow whoever is messy to sit next to her.

Example
